Abstract

The reform of the criminal procedure legislation and the judicial system of Ukraine actualises the need to clarify the boundaries of the court’s activity in criminal proceedings, its role in collecting, verifying, and evaluating evidence to establish circumstances relevant to criminal proceedings. The purpose of the study is to investigate the provisions of the current criminal procedure legislation in terms of examination and evaluation of evidence by the court. A system of general scientific and special research methods was used to achieve the goals set, including dialectical, system and structural, statistical, and system analysis methods. It is proved that within the framework of judicial proceedings, a judge, as a subject of examination and evaluation of evidence, carries out certain research activities. It is proved that this activity is aimed at establishing circumstances and reproducing certain fragments of reality that prove or refute the facts, which results in the formation of an internal conviction in the judge and, ultimately, a court decision. The priority importance of such a basis of criminal proceedings as the immediacy of the examination of testimony, items, and documents is emphasised, which contributes to the full clarification of the circumstances of the proceedings and its objective solution. The study results will contribute to the development of the justice system, considering the best international practices in the context of adversarial criminal proceedings, ensuring the correct and timely consideration of criminal proceedings
